LAHORE: Pakistan International Airlines’ ( PIA ) premier service has incurred losses of Rs. 1.5 billion in first three months since its starting.

According to reports, Rs1.29 billion payment was carried out as a rent of planes taken on wait lease while Rs1 crore was paid in London for the limousine service of the passengers.

While talking to the channel, controller South news, Rehan Hashmi, said that despite the claims of profit by PIA, the service is facing the deficit.

“When PIA started it in 2016, it was stated that the service will be started from Lahore, Karachi and Islamabad to London but due to its high prices and low numbers of passengers, the services remained unable to meet its expectations,” he said.

However, PIA spokesman said that the reason behind the loss is to wait lease aircraft.
